Sump Pump Overflow Water Removal Cost in Star, ID

The cost of sump pump overflow water removal in Star, ID varies depending on the sever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and local conditions. Here’s a breakdown of what you can expect: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water removal and extraction $500 – $2,500 Severity of damage, size of affected area
Drying and dehumidification $300 – $1,500 Size of affected area, type of equipment used
Cleaning and disinfecting $200 – $1,000 Size of affected area, type of cleaning solutions used
Restoration and repair $1,000 – $5,000 Scope of project, type of materials used
Insurance claims and paperwork $100 – $500 Complexity of claim, number of parties involved
